Cyber security has become essential because so much of modern life now depends on computers, smartphones, cloud platforms, online banking, digital communication, and connected devices. Every time people create an account, make a payment, upload a document, or access business systems, valuable information travels across digital networks that can be targeted by attackers.
The purpose of cyber security is to protect systems, networks, applications, and data from unauthorized access, theft, disruption, and damage. It combines technology, policies, awareness, and good digital habits to reduce security risks. Strong protection helps individuals and organizations continue using digital services without constantly exposing themselves to preventable threats.
Understanding why cyber security is important is no longer something only IT professionals need to consider. Businesses, governments, schools, healthcare organizations, and everyday internet users all face digital risks. Knowing the benefits of cyber security can help people make safer decisions, protect valuable information, and respond more effectively when security problems occur.
Cyber Security Protects Sensitive Personal Information
Personal information has significant value because it can include names, passwords, addresses, financial details, identity documents, and private communications. If cybercriminals gain access to this information, they may use it for identity theft, account takeovers, fraud, or unauthorized transactions. Cyber security measures help prevent attackers from accessing sensitive data without permission.
Strong passwords, multi-factor authentication, encrypted connections, secure devices, and updated software all help protect personal information. These measures create additional barriers between attackers and valuable accounts. Even simple security habits can make unauthorized access considerably more difficult when criminals rely on weak passwords, outdated applications, or careless online behavior.
Protecting personal data also helps people maintain privacy in an increasingly connected world. Information shared with banks, employers, retailers, social platforms, and online services should not become easily accessible to criminals. Effective cyber security reduces unnecessary exposure and gives individuals greater control over who can access their private digital information.
Cyber Security Helps Prevent Financial Loss
Cyberattacks can cause direct financial losses for individuals and businesses. Criminals may steal payment information, compromise online banking accounts, demand ransomware payments, or use stolen credentials to make unauthorized purchases. Preventing these incidents is often far less expensive than recovering money and rebuilding systems after a successful security breach.
Businesses can experience even greater costs when cyber incidents interrupt operations. Recovery expenses may include technical investigations, system restoration, legal support, customer communication, security upgrades, and lost productivity. Depending on the incident, organizations may also lose revenue while websites, payment systems, or internal applications remain unavailable.
Good cyber security reduces financial risk by identifying weaknesses before attackers exploit them. Regular updates, access controls, secure backups, employee training, and threat monitoring can reduce both the likelihood and impact of an attack. These protections help organizations use technology productively without exposing unnecessary financial vulnerabilities.
Cyber Security Keeps Businesses Running
Modern businesses depend heavily on technology for communication, customer management, inventory, payments, accounting, marketing, and daily operations. A cyberattack that disables important systems can prevent employees from working and customers from completing transactions. Even a short disruption may create operational problems that spread across different departments.
Business continuity depends on preparing for both attacks and technical failures. Secure backups, disaster recovery plans, network protection, and incident response procedures help organizations restore important services after an unexpected problem. The goal is not only to stop every attack but also to reduce downtime when something goes wrong.
Organizations that prepare for cyber incidents can usually respond more calmly and efficiently. Employees know who should be contacted, important data can be restored, and critical systems receive priority. This preparation helps companies maintain essential operations while security teams investigate the incident and reduce the risk of further damage.

Cyber Security Defends Against Ransomware and Malware
Malware is malicious software designed to damage systems, steal data, monitor activity, or provide attackers with unauthorized access. It can enter devices through infected downloads, malicious attachments, compromised websites, or vulnerable software. Cyber security tools and safe browsing practices help detect and block many of these threats before they cause serious harm.
Ransomware is particularly disruptive because it can encrypt files or lock organizations out of important systems. Attackers may then demand payment in exchange for restoring access. Reliable backups, updated systems, endpoint protection, access controls, and employee awareness can reduce the likelihood that ransomware spreads throughout an entire network.
Prevention is important because recovering from malware can be complicated and expensive. Removing malicious software does not always guarantee that stolen information has been recovered or deleted by attackers. A layered security approach makes it harder for criminals to enter systems, expand their access, and cause widespread disruption.
Cyber Security Reduces Phishing and Social Engineering Risks
Many cyberattacks begin with people rather than advanced technical exploits. Phishing messages often imitate trusted companies, coworkers, banks, or online services to trick recipients into clicking malicious links or revealing login information. These attacks can appear convincing, especially when criminals use familiar branding or urgent language.
Cyber security awareness training teaches people how to recognize suspicious messages, unusual login requests, unexpected attachments, and fake websites. Employees should also understand how to verify requests involving payments, passwords, or sensitive documents. Combining user education with email filtering and multi-factor authentication creates stronger protection against social engineering.
Human error cannot be eliminated completely, which is why organizations should avoid relying on awareness alone. Technical controls can limit the damage caused by one mistaken click or compromised password. When training and technology work together, businesses can reduce the chances that a simple phishing attempt becomes a major security incident.
Cyber Security Supports Remote Work and Cloud Services
Remote work has increased the number of locations, devices, and networks employees use to access company information. Workers may connect from homes, shared spaces, mobile devices, or personal internet connections. Each additional access point can create new security risks if authentication, devices, and network connections are not properly protected.
Cloud services also store large amounts of valuable business information outside traditional office environments. Companies use cloud platforms for files, email, collaboration, software, analytics, and infrastructure. Strong access controls, account permissions, encryption, monitoring, and secure configuration help organizations benefit from cloud technology without unnecessarily exposing sensitive information.
Modern cyber security focuses on protecting users and data wherever they are located. This includes verifying identities, controlling access, securing endpoints, and monitoring suspicious activity. As work becomes more distributed, businesses need security strategies that protect information beyond the physical boundaries of an office network.
Cyber Security Protects Critical Infrastructure
Critical infrastructure includes systems that support electricity, transportation, communications, water, healthcare, financial services, and other essential functions. Many of these services depend on digital networks and connected technology. A successful cyberattack against important infrastructure can therefore affect communities far beyond the organization that was originally targeted.
Security in these environments is especially important because disruption can create physical as well as financial consequences. Attackers may attempt to interrupt operations, steal sensitive information, or interfere with industrial systems. Strong network segmentation, monitoring, access controls, secure updates, and incident planning can help reduce these risks.
Protecting critical infrastructure requires cooperation between technical teams, organizations, governments, and service providers. No single security tool can address every possible threat. Effective protection depends on understanding vulnerabilities, preparing for incidents, sharing relevant threat information, and continuously improving security as technology and attacker techniques change.
Cyber Security Helps Organizations Meet Compliance Requirements
Many industries must follow rules and standards related to privacy, information security, and data protection. These requirements may define how sensitive information should be stored, accessed, processed, or reported after a security incident. Cyber security controls help organizations create systems and procedures that support these responsibilities.
Compliance can include access management, security documentation, employee training, data protection, incident reporting, and regular risk assessments. The exact requirements depend on the organization’s location, industry, customers, and type of information being handled. Businesses should understand which regulations apply to them instead of assuming one security framework fits every situation.
Compliance alone does not automatically make an organization secure, but it can provide useful minimum standards. Strong cyber security goes beyond checking required boxes by addressing real risks and changing threats. Organizations should treat compliance as one part of a broader security strategy rather than the final goal.
Cyber Security Is Important for Small Businesses
Small businesses sometimes assume cybercriminals are interested only in large companies, but attackers often look for easy opportunities rather than specific company sizes. Smaller organizations may have fewer security resources, limited IT staff, or weaker systems. These conditions can make poorly protected businesses attractive targets for automated attacks and credential theft.
A serious cyber incident can be particularly difficult for a small company because recovery costs may represent a larger percentage of available resources. Lost customer data, disrupted payments, or unavailable systems can immediately affect revenue. Basic protections can therefore provide significant value without requiring an enterprise-level security budget.
Small businesses can begin with practical measures such as strong passwords, multi-factor authentication, regular backups, software updates, restricted access, and employee awareness. These actions address many common weaknesses. As the company grows, security processes can expand alongside the number of employees, applications, customers, and digital assets being managed.
Cyber Security Creates Growing Career Opportunities
The growing dependence on digital technology has increased the need for professionals who can protect networks, cloud systems, applications, devices, and sensitive information. Cyber security includes many career paths, such as security analysis, penetration testing, incident response, governance, cloud security, digital forensics, and security engineering.
People considering this field often research current skills, job roles, certifications, and overall cyber security demand before choosing a learning path. The industry requires both technical specialists and professionals who understand risk management, compliance, communication, training, and security operations across different types of organizations.
Cyber security careers also require continuous learning because technology and attack methods keep changing. Professionals need to understand emerging threats, new platforms, updated defensive tools, and evolving security practices. This constant development can make the field demanding, but it also creates opportunities for people who enjoy solving problems and learning new skills.
Cyber Security Is Everyone’s Responsibility
Cyber security is often viewed as the responsibility of an IT department, but everyone who uses technology can influence security. Employees, customers, managers, and individual users make daily decisions involving passwords, links, downloads, files, devices, and personal information. One unsafe action can sometimes create an opportunity for attackers.
Organizations can create a stronger security culture by making safe behavior simple and understandable. Employees should know how to report suspicious emails, protect credentials, handle sensitive information, and recognize unusual requests. Clear policies are more effective when people understand why they exist instead of treating security as an obstacle to their work.
Individuals should follow similar habits in their personal digital lives. Updating devices, using unique passwords, enabling multi-factor authentication, avoiding suspicious links, and backing up important files can significantly reduce common risks. Cyber security works best when technology and responsible user behavior support each other consistently.
